Latest Patents

Cynthia holds a patent for a "Multilayer solid phase immunoassay support and method of use." This innovative immunoassay is capable of simultaneously detecting various antigens from one or multiple infectious agents, as well as immunoglobulins. The method involves contacting a test sample with a solid support that has immobilized antigens, allowing for the formation and detection of antigen-antibody complexes.
